Organizing a symposium on water saving



Tuesday، 13 June 2017

   Sponsored by the dean of Collage of Science professor Dr. Hadi M. Ali Abood from the Chemistry Department organized a specialized symposium on water saving to improve environmental practices related to water, in the Faw hall according to the directives from the ministry of education and scientific research, where the lecturer assistant professor Wedad H.Shaban whose a tutor in the Chemistry Department indicated that the water crisis in Iraq is one of the most important problems facing the Economic of Iraq especially the agricultural sector as Iraq is known as an agricultural country mentioning the majority of water crises, even if it’snot clearly appeared but it will be so dangerous in the future. He also indicated the shortness and pollution of water which is a serious responsibility to the citizens to solve such problem by obtaining “water consciousness" to develop good attitudes and behaviors to deal with water resources aiming to conserve water to be exploited better.

 

 

At the end of the symposium some topic where put basically to encourage the researchers, tutors and postgraduate students to redirect all research’s properly to treat water shortness by different ways of rationalization and to introduce materials that decreases the plants water needs or even to grow in salt areas this is an important feature in agricultural whereas plants consume more than 75% of water available mentioning the large areas in Iraq that experiences salinity although mentioning introduction of new industrial ways used to recycle used water rather than discharging it in the rivers that cause pollution. The attendances are colleagues from the collage of science and students.
